Job Description

The following provides a non-exhaustive list of the duties and responsibilities that fall within the remit of the company accountant:

  • Responsible for managing all financial and administrative operations for the business
  • Overall control of sales, purchases, stock and nominal ledgers
  • Production of monthly, and 6 Month management accounts and working with the GM and dept managers to provide information that aids business growth and improvement
  • Production of annual accounts together with supporting schedules for audit
  • Grain administration including recording harvest intake, paying members for grain and maintaining grain ledgers
  • Monitoring daily bank & cash balances
  • Annual cash flow projections
  • Payroll including PAYE & benefits in kind
  • VAT
  • Completion of returns and questionnaires for government & other agencies
  • Company pension scheme
  • Maintain share registers & company database
  • Administer and renew insurance policies
  • Management & development of two FT admin staff
  • Managing the operation and development of the company’s IT hardware and software (in conjunction with our external IT support contractor)

o Accounts package: Pegasus Opera 3 plus Opera XRL

o Microsoft Office 365 to include Outlook, Excel, Word & Access

o KCPOS till software

o Precia Molen GeneSYS weighbridge software

o SIP phone system
